Research articles should also … Web10 jun. 2024 · 2. MAXQDA. MAXQDA is a qualitative data analysis software that's designed for companies analyzing different types of customer data. The software allows you to import data from interviews, focus groups, surveys, videos, and even social media. This way you can review all of your qualitative data in one central location.

Web8 mrt. 2024 · Generally speaking, qualitative research explores what people think, feel, and do. It’s non-numerical, which means your insights will consist of words and stories, like people talking about their experiences and sharing their opinions. You tend to be dealing with a small sample here.
